Description
Inspired by the Hephaestus the Greek mythological god of blacksmiths, metallurgy, and fire. Sorge maintains an immense amount of control with the swirling steel of this piece, each curve is ever so graceful. Layers of various toned patinas are used to achieve the rich color throughout the piece, which exudes subtly graceful tonal nuances. He then sets the piece atop a solid cylindrical piece of plasma cut steel.
